Just read that a single mature tree can absorb over 48 pounds of carbon dioxide a year

That Portland report is a good start, but the "over 48 pounds" figure is a general average. Fast growing trees like poplars or pines can absorb a lot more, especially when they're young. The type and age of the tree makes a huge difference.
